Sticking around the Big Apple
LBNew York Jets
January 11, 2023
The Jets signed Surratt to a reserve/future contract Wednesday, Ethan Greenberg of the team's official site reports.
ANALYSIS
Despite suiting up for just one game this past season, Surratt is slated to remain with the Jets heading into the 2023-24 campaign. The 2021 third-round draft pick by Minnesota has yet to take a defensive snap as a pro.

2021 Fantasy Outlook
Surratt (6-2, 229) is a former quarterback who dominated at linebacker for North Carolina after converting before the 2019 season. He posted 115 tackles (15 for loss) and 6.5 sacks in 13 games that year, before totaling another 91 stops (7.5 for loss) and six sacks across 11 games in 2020. With a 4.59 40 and standout quickness, Surratt has three-down potential once the Vikings move on from Anthony Barr. Surratt will compete with Nick Vigil for playing time at weak-side linebacker in training camp.
